Revolutionary Pyro Language Now Available on PyPI: Unlock New Coding Potential
In a groundbreaking development, the Pyro language, a more intuitive and user-friendly alternative to Python that compiles to Python, has officially been made available on the Python Package Index (PyPI). This significant milestone is poised to revolutionize the coding landscape by offering developers an enhanced programming experience.
At its core, Pyro is designed to simplify the coding process by introducing a more streamlined syntax and improved readability, making it an attractive option for both novice and experienced programmers. By compiling to Python, Pyro ensures seamless integration with existing Python ecosystems, allowing developers to leverage the extensive libraries and resources available. The language's innovative approach has garnered significant attention within the developer community, with many anticipating its potential to boost productivity and reduce the learning curve associated with traditional Python.
Key developments driving Pyro's release include its enhanced syntax, which eliminates the need for unnecessary boilerplate code, and its compatibility with Python's vast array of libraries. This compatibility ensures that Pyro can be used for a wide range of applications, from web development and data analysis to artificial intelligence and more. Furthermore, the Pyro development team has implemented a robust testing framework, guaranteeing the stability and reliability of the language.
